Noah Lake Information

Noah Lake is a small body of water located in Michigan, primarily known for its recreational opportunities such as fishing and boating. Here’s some general information that might be helpful:

Fishing
- Fish Species: Noah Lake is typically home to a variety of fish species, including bluegill, crappie, bass, and pike. The specific species can vary, so it’s a good idea to check local fishing reports or ask local anglers for the latest information.
- Fishing Regulations: Always be sure to check the Michigan Department of Natural Resources (DNR) regulations for fishing licenses, limits, and any specific regulations related to Noah Lake.

Boating
- Boat Access: Noah Lake may have public access points or boat launches, but availability may vary. It’s best to confirm local access details ahead of your visit.
- Boat Types: Small boats, kayaks, and canoes are typically suitable for use on smaller lakes like Noah Lake. Be mindful of speed limits and no-wake zones if applicable.

Other Recreation
- In addition to fishing and boating, Noah Lake may offer opportunities for hiking, bird watching, and picnicking around its shores. These activities can enhance your experience in the beautiful natural surroundings.

Local Amenities
- Check for nearby amenities such as bait shops, convenience stores, and rental services for boats or fishing equipment. Local towns may also have lodging options if you’re planning to stay overnight.

Safety & Conservation
- Always prioritize safety when boating and ensure you’re wearing life jackets when required. Respect local wildlife and practice Leave No Trace principles to preserve the natural beauty of Noah Lake.
